An Akure Chief Magistrate Court yesterday remanded a 53-year-old woman, Rachael Abodunrinde, in prison for the murder of a 10-month-old baby, Toluwa Fadahunsi, Vanguard is reporting.

The suspect, according to the prosecuting witness, cracked the toddler’s skull with a stone.

Abodunrinde, who is a family member to the father of the deceased, was caught in the act shortly after she committed the offence in the deceased mothers bedroom.

Police Prosecutor, Mr Zakari Ibrahim, told the court that the incident occurred on April 30, 2013 at about 12:50 p.m at Iju, Akure North Local Government Area of Ondo State.

According to the charge sheet, the offence is punishable under Section 319(1) of the Criminal Code Cap 37 Vol. 1 Laws of Ondo State of Nigeria 2006.

Ibrahim therefore urged the court to remand the suspect in prison to enable him duplicate the case file with the Director of Public Prosecution, DPP, for legal advice.

In her ruling, the Chief Magistrate, Mr Johnson Adelegan adjourned the case to June 21, 2013 pending the DPP’s advice.
